CPCB Multi-Year History (2016–2024)
Summary
Overview
In 2024, Gadag averaged an AQI of 53 while Kalaburagi averaged 49 — a 4-point (8%) gap, with Gadag the more polluted and Kalaburagi the cleaner of the two. On 635 days when both cities reported, Gadag was cleaner on 427 of them; the average daily gap was 27 AQI points.
Seasonality & days
Gadag peaks in March, while Kalaburagi peaks in December. Gadag logged 0.3% Severe days and 96.1% Good-or-Satisfactory days; Kalaburagi was 0.6% Severe and 69.6% Good-or-Satisfactory. Longest clean-air streaks: Gadag 50 days, Kalaburagi 120 days.
Year-over-year progress
Gadag has worsened by 10 AQI points (23.3%) from 2021 to 2024; Kalaburagi has improved by 56 AQI points (53.3%) over the same window. The worst recorded day for Gadag reached AQI 500 at Panchal Nagar (KSPCB) on 2022-12-10; Kalaburagi hit AQI 500 at Lal Bahadur Shastri Nagar (KSPCB) on 2020-10-26.
Station-level disparity
Gadag spans 1 CPCB stations with a 0-point spread (min 54, max 54); Kalaburagi spans 2 stations with a 40-point spread (min 43, max 83).
